原文:【Elasticsearch学习】DSL搜索大全

.复合查询 复合查询能够组合其他复合查询或者查询子句,同时也可以组合各个查询的查询结果及得分,也可以从Query查询转换为Filter过滤器查询。 首先介绍一下Query Context和 Filter Context Query Context查询主要关注的是文档和查询条件的匹配度,Query查询会计算文档和查询条件的相关度评分。 Filter Context过滤器主要关注文档是否匹配查询条件 ...

2020-05-25 22:32 0 769 推荐指数:

查看详情

Elasticsearch(ES)的高级搜索DSL搜索)(上篇)

1. 概述 之前聊了一下 Elasticsearch(ES)的基本使用,今天我们聊聊 Elasticsearch(ES)的高级搜索DSL搜索),由于DSL搜索内容比较多,因此分为两篇文章完成。 2. 场景说明 2.1 创建索引同时创建映射 PUT http ...

Tue Sep 21 00:36:00 CST 2021 0 277
Elasticsearch (DSL搜索 - term/match terms)

term精确搜索与match分词搜索 match 搜索结果如下 查询结果4条记录 其中最后一条结果进行 证明进行分词匹配 我叫凌云慕 trem 精确查询 查询结果三条记录 只能查询包含慕课网整体的词汇 可以借助 elasticsearch-head工具查看刚才查询情况 match ...

Tue Apr 14 07:01:00 CST 2020 0 661
elasticsearch系列四:搜索详解(搜索API、Query DSL

一、搜索API 1. 搜索API 端点地址 从索引tweet里面搜索字段user为kimchy的记录 从索引tweet,user里面搜索字段user为kimchy的记录 从所有索引里面搜索字段tag为wow的记录 说明:搜索 ...

Fri Jun 22 08:39:00 CST 2018 0 11031
学习python库:elasticsearch-dsl

一、简介 elasticsearch-dsl是基于elasticsearch-py封装实现的,提供了更简便的操作elasticsearch的方法。 二、具体使用 elasticsearch的官方文档介绍一共包括六个部分,分别是:configuration、search dsl ...

Sun Jan 12 09:26:00 CST 2020 1 5633
利用kibana学习 elasticsearch restful api (DSL)

利用kibana学习 elasticsearch restful api (DSL) 1、了解elasticsearch基本概念Index: databaseType: tableDocument: rowFiled: field 2、关键字:PUT 创建索引,eg:PUT ...

Tue Oct 01 22:24:00 CST 2019 0 461
ElasticSearch的 Query DSL 和 Filter DSL

Elasticsearch支持很多查询方式,其中一种就是DSL,它是把请求写在JSON里面,然后进行相关的查询。 Query DSL 与 Filter DSL DSL查询语言中存在两种:查询DSL(query DSL)和过滤DSL(filter DSL)。 它们两个的区别如下图 ...

Sat Mar 19 00:45:00 CST 2016 1 11237
python| Django Elasticsearch DSL

Django Elasticsearch DSL 介绍 Django Elasticsearch DSL是一个软件包,允许在elasticsearch中索引Django模型。它是作为Elasticsearch-dsl-py的封装而构建的, 因此您可以使 ...

Sat Dec 05 20:26:00 CST 2020 0 670
Query DSL for elasticsearch Query

Query DSL Query DSL (资料来自: http://www.elasticsearch.cn/guide/reference/query-dsl/) http://elasticsearch.qiniudn.com/ --简介-- elasticsearch 提供 ...

Fri Jan 09 01:50:00 CST 2015 0 8424
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M